How Much Does a Circulations Director Make in Manta?

A Circulations Director working in Manta will typically earn around 21,100 USD per year, and this can range from the lowest average salary of about 8,560 USD to the highest average salary of 30,700 USD.

Average Annual Salary21,100 USD
Average Monthly Salary1,758 USD
Average Lowest Salary8,560 USD
Lowest Monthly Salary713 USD
Average Highest Salary30,700 USD
Highest Monthly Salary2,558 USD

These are average salaries for a Circulations Director in Manta and include benefits such as housing and transport. It's also possible for a Circulations Director to earn more or less than the average salaries shown above.

Circulations Director Salary by Experience Level in Manta

The most important factor in determining your salary after the specific profession is the number of years experience you have. It stands to reason that more years of experience will result in a higher wage.

We have researched the average Circulations Director salary based on years of experience to give you an idea of how the average changes once you've worked for a certain amount of time.

  • 0 - 2 Years Experience. A Circulations Director in Manta that has less than two years of experience can expect to earn somewhere in the region of 8,880 USD.
  • 2 - 5 Years Experience. With two to five years of experience the average Circulations Director salary would increase to 12,580 USD.
  • 5 - 10 Years Experience. From five to ten years of experience as a Circulations Director, the average salary would be 21,400 USD.
  • 10 - 15 Years Experience. Once you have more than ten years of experience the average salary reaches around 27,380 USD.
  • 15 - 20 Years Experience. A Circulations Director with 15 to 20 years of experience can earn an average of 28,660 USD.
  • 20+ Years Experience. For a Circulations Director with more than 20 years, the expected average salary increases to 29,640 USD.

Circulations Director Salary Compared by Gender

In the modern age, we know that there should never be a pay gap between men and women. Unfortunately, in many professions, there is still a significant difference between the salaries earned by men when compared to the salary of women in the same job.

In Manta, a male circulations director will earn an average of 23,400 USD, while a female circulations director will earn around 19,160 USD.

This means that a male circulations director earns approximately 22% more than a female circulations director for performing the same job.

Circulations Director Average Pay Raise in Manta

In many countries, an annual pay raise is often given to employees to reward their service with a salary increase.

From our research, we can see that the average pay raise for a Circulations Director in Manta is around 10% every 21 months.

The national average pay raise across all professions and industries in Ecuador is around 7% every 19 months.

In this case, we can see that the number of months between the average pay raise is higher than the typical 12 months.

To make the data more meaningful, we can calculate what the approximate annual pay raise would be using a simple formula:

Annual Increase = ( Increase Rate ÷ Months ) × 12

So for this example, it would be:

Annual Increase = ( 10 ÷ 21 ) × 12  = 6%

What this means is that a Circulations Director in Manta can expect to receive an average pay raise of around 6% every 12 months.
